Transaction 404329264a76a7eab8021163f798cacb6c42f53d8c173af64d4e03dab581ee93

1 Input
2 Outputs
  • 404329264a76a7eab8021163f798cacb6c42f53d8c173af64d4e03dab581ee93:0
  • value  13925335
    address  321UCcLFmGWwjp1yqLPqwyarJzxX9DXXNF
  • 404329264a76a7eab8021163f798cacb6c42f53d8c173af64d4e03dab581ee93:1
  • value  720000
    address  36DAeJRJ8oLjYELN6GezBdMnjmTdD4yhHx